14 Hottest Restaurants in Charlotte, February 2025

"Chef Ammalu Saleh of Serengeti Kitchen puts Tanzanian flavors in the spotlight at Uptown’s 7th Street Market. From the tender chicken in a biryani marinade down to the tamarind juice, the spices, from cardamom to chili, pack a punch. The Swahili plate of fluffy coconut rice, chicken, collards, and plantains is a must-get. The $20 and below prices are a nice touch, too." - Kayleigh Ruller
